Crime overview

Egerton Road area has the 5th highest crime rate of 42 local areas in Claremont , and the 35th highest crime rate of 494 local areas in Blackpool .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Egerton Road (FY1 2NL) in the last 12 months was 594.5 per 1,000 residents and was 29.2% higher than the Claremont average (460.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 64 offences recorded. The least common crime was Robbery with 3 cases , up 50.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 433.3%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-27.3%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 75 (β‰ˆ 257.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-6.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-41.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Egerton Road (FY1 2NL), the main crime hotspot is near Nightclub. Police recorded 233 crimes here, including 125 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
